
30 Minute Tuna Burgers

Serves/Makes: 4 | Ready In: < 30 minutes
2 eggs
1/3 cup dry bread crumbs
1 tablespoon chopped fresh dill
1 tablespoon horseradish, drained
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
1 pinch sal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
13 ounces canned water-packed tuna, well drained
2 green onions, minced
1 celery stalk, chopped
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
4 whole-wheat hamburger buns, toasted if desired
Beat the eggs in a bowl. Add the bread crumbs, dill, horseradish, mustard, salt, and pepper. Mix well.
Add the tuna, onions, and celery. Stir so the tuna flakes and is well mixed. Shape the tuna mixture into 1/2-inch thick burgers and set aside.
Heat the o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the burgers and cook for 10 minutes, turning halfway through the cooking time. The burgers should be golden brown and firm when cooked.
Place the burgers on the buns and top with any desired condiments. Serve immediately.

per serving: 388 calories, 10g fat, 37g carbohydrates, 35g protein.
